Dissecting REDD+ costs sustainable settlements in the Amazon and Katingan peat conservation area

AUTHOR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ations
Eduardo Marinho speaks at the Economics of Climate Change Mitigation Options in the Forest Sector international online conference. Organized by the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ations in February 2015, the conference explored how a wide range of different interventions in the forest sector might help to mitigate climate change, based on existing country experiences as well as analyses of the costs and benefits of various options under a range of different circumstances.
